What is the primary purpose of Stockanalyzer?
Stockanalyzer is a financial platform designed to assist investors in performing fundamental analysis and determining the intrinsic value of various stocks through quantitative models.
Which valuation methods are available on Stockanalyzer?
The platform provides several valuation tools, most notably the Discounted Cash Flow analysis, which helps users estimate a company's fair value based on projected future earnings.
Does Stockanalyzer provide historical financial data?
Yes, it offers access to extensive historical financial statements, including balance sheets, income statements, and cash flow data, allowing users to evaluate a company's past performance.
How does Stockanalyzer assist in identifying undervalued stocks?
By comparing the calculated intrinsic value derived from financial models to the current market price, the tool highlights whether a stock is trading at a discount or a premium.
Is Stockanalyzer suitable for long-term value investors?
The platform is specifically tailored for value investing strategies, focusing on fundamental business metrics and long-term financial health rather than short-term technical indicators.
